General description
The 74HC251-Q100; 74HCT251-Q100 is an 8-bit multiplexer with eight binary inputs (I0 to I7), three select inputs (S0 to S2) and an output enable input (OE). The select inputs select one of the eight binary inputs and route it to the complementary outputs (Y and Y) A HIGH on OE causes the outputs to assume a high-impedance OFF-state. Inputs include clamp diodes that enable the use of current limiting resistors to interface inputs to voltages in excess of VCC.
This product has been qualified to the Automotive Electronics Council (AEC) standard Q100 (Grade 1) and is suitable for use in automotive applications.
Features and benefits
■ Automotive product qualification in accordance with AEC-Q100 (Grade 1)
◆ Specified from -40°C to +85°C and from -40°C to +125°C
■ Input levels:
◆ For 74HC251-Q100: CMOS level
◆ For 74HCT251-Q100: TTL level
■ Low-power dissipation
■ Non-inverting data path
■ Specified in compliance with JEDEC standard no. 7A
■ ESD protection:
◆ MIL-STD-883, method 3015 exceeds 2000 V
◆ HBM JESD22-A114F exceeds 2000 V
◆ MM JESD22-A115-A exceeds 200 V (C = 200 pF, R = 0 Ω)
■ Multiple package options
